Changed defaults in Splitfork, our assignment service. Bucketing now uses sticky hashing per account instead of per session, and the holdout slice grew from 2% to 5%. Callers relying on session-level reassignment must opt in explicitly. Review the diff against the new baseline; the updated default configuration is listed below.

config for tagep-kajof:
[casir]
port = 6379
region = south-1
host = casir.paliqdyn.example
team = tamax
timeout_ms = 250
retries = 2

## Account Recovery — Trailnote Offline Mode

When a surveyor's Trailnote app has been offline for 30+ days, their local credentials expire and sync refuses to resume. Don't make them wipe the device — all their unsynced field data lives there! Instead, open the support console, pick "Offline Reinstate," and enter their handle. The console will ask for the support team's shared recovery passphrase before issuing a reinstatement token. Use the one below.

unlock words, bagaf-fajeg: zorael-kelax-fraath-quenix-eliok-sileth-aldmir-wenir-druiel

Finance Review Summary — Customer Concentration, Verelux Group

Revenue concentration remains elevated: the Dunmoor account represents 31% of recurring income, up from 26% last year. Two further accounts together add 18%. Contract renewal timing clusters in the second quarter, compounding exposure. Heads of department should factor this into hiring and inventory commitments. Mitigation options are under review, and the confidential note below sets out the plan.

internal memo for faweg-hahip: Silokix Works plans to lower the Tamvan list price by 8 percent in June.

Hey,

Quick heads-up before the next cut: ownership of the date-format localization work in Mapletide is moving. We've finished the locale bundles for the dashboard, but the invoice templates still hardcode month-day-year, which keeps tripping up our Southhaven pilot users. Please don't ship the release until the template fixes land or get an explicit waiver. If anything date-related shows up in release triage, don't guess at formats yourself — loop in the new owner. For sign-off and escalations, that person is named below.

account owner for bawip-tahag: Raleth Quenok